Transaction dbb3c2f77dca546a7a25cf263f4d8adfa505c357ffd229cce7b817c0c25f5d62
1 Input
1 Output
-
dbb3c2f77dca546a7a25cf263f4d8adfa505c357ffd229cce7b817c0c25f5d62:0
- value
- 2479887
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ca3baa89807612e5fdc856e58e02e3211f940a0 OP_EQUAL
- address
- 3EWefVwRAEMGwK5t3bcCBdpzf7zppDNWVT